About 4-chloro-7,7-difluoro-2-[(2S)-2-methylazetidin-1-yl]-5,6-dihydrocyclopenta[d]pyrimidine
4-chloro-7,7-difluoro-2-[(2S)-2-methylazetidin-1-yl]-5,6-dihydrocyclopenta[d]pyrimidine (PubChem CID 165396021) has the molecular formula C11H12ClF2N3
and a molecular weight of 259.69 g/mol. Its IUPAC name is 4-chloro-7,7-difluoro-2-[(2S)-2-methylazetidin-1-yl]-5,6-dihydrocyclopenta[d]pyrimidine.

What is the SMILES notation for 4-chloro-7,7-difluoro-2-[(2S)-2-methylazetidin-1-yl]-5,6-dihydrocyclopenta[d]pyrimidine?
The canonical SMILES for 4-chloro-7,7-difluoro-2-[(2S)-2-methylazetidin-1-yl]-5,6-dihydrocyclopenta[d]pyrimidine is C[C@H]1CCN1c1nc(Cl)c2c(n1)C(F)(F)CC2.
What is the InChIKey of 4-chloro-7,7-difluoro-2-[(2S)-2-methylazetidin-1-yl]-5,6-dihydrocyclopenta[d]pyrimidine?
The InChIKey is SETJCPRRODCQEH-LURJTMIESA-N. The full InChI is InChI=1S/C11H12ClF2N3/c1-6-3-5-17(6)10-15-8-7(9(12)16-10)2-4-11(8,13)14/h6H,2-5H2,1H3/t6-/m0/s1.
What are the key properties of 4-chloro-7,7-difluoro-2-[(2S)-2-methylazetidin-1-yl]-5,6-dihydrocyclopenta[d]pyrimidine?
4-chloro-7,7-difluoro-2-[(2S)-2-methylazetidin-1-yl]-5,6-dihydrocyclopenta[d]pyrimidine has a molecular weight of 259.69 g/mol, XLogP of 2.77, 1 rotatable bonds, 0 hydrogen bond donors, and 3 hydrogen bond acceptors.
